What I Learned About Accreditation for Online MBA Dubai Programs
Ok so this is SUPER important and honestly the most confusing part of researching online mba dubai options. Not all accreditations are equal, and some online mba dubai programs have basically fake accreditation.
The Accreditations That Actually Matter
After talking to HR professionals, hiring managers, and people who’d done online mba dubai programs, I learned these are the real accreditations:
- AACSB (American) – this is like the gold standard for online mba dubai programs
- AMBA (British) – also highly respected globally
- EQUIS (European) – third major international accreditation
- UAE Ministry of Education recognition – crucial if you want local recognition
Good online mba dubai programs will have at least one of these, ideally multiple. The best ones have triple accreditation (all three international ones) but those are expensive af.
The online mba dubai program I almost wasted money on? They had some random “International Council for Distance Education” accreditation that literally nobody recognizes lol. Red flag city.
Local Recognition Matters
Some online mba dubai degrees are recognized internationally but NOT by UAE’s Ministry of Education, which can be a problem if you want government jobs or need attestation for visa purposes. Always check both international AND local recognition.

The Real Costs of Online MBA Dubai Programs
Lets talk money because this is probably what your most concerned about when researching online mba dubai options.
Tuition Fee Ranges
Based on my research of legit online mba dubai programs with proper accreditation:
- Budget options: 45,000-65,000 AED (some compromises on prestige)
- Mid-range: 70,000-120,000 AED (good quality, recognized degrees)
- Premium: 130,000-200,000+ AED (top international schools)
I paid 85,000 AED for my online mba dubai which I consider mid-range. Programs cheaper than 40k are usually not properly accredited (based on my research). Programs over 150k are often from schools like IMD, INSEAD, or London Business School – prestigious but tbh probably overkill unless your aiming for C-suite roles.
Hidden Costs Nobody Tells You
Taking an online mba dubai costs more than just tuition fr:
- Textbooks and materials: about 2,500 AED (some online mba dubai programs include this, mine didn’t)
- Technology: upgraded my laptop for 4,800 AED, needed better webcam for 350 AED
- Exam fees: some modules have proctored exams with fees (500-800 AED total for my program)
- Printing and supplies: maybe 400 AED over 2 years
- Caffeine budget: probably spent 3,000 AED on coffee during late-night study sessions lol

Different Types of Online MBA Dubai Options Available
Not all online mba dubai programs follow the same format. Here’s what I’ve learned about the options:
Fully Online MBA Dubai
Programs like mine where everything is online except optional networking events. Good for flexibility, works if you’re disciplined. Most common online mba dubai format.
Hybrid Online MBA Dubai
Some online mba dubai programs require campus visits – maybe once a month or intensive weekends every quarter. Places like SP Jain and Manipal offer hybrid online mba dubai options. More interaction but less flexible.
Part-Time Evening MBA Dubai
Not technically “online” but relevant – programs like American University Dubai offer evening MBAs with significant online components. More structure than pure online mba dubai programs but requires physical attendance.
Executive MBA Dubai
Designed for senior professionals, usually faster-paced and more expensive. Some have online mba dubai delivery with periodic residencies. Schools like INSEAD and IMD offer EMBA with online components.
Choosing the Right Online MBA Dubai Program for Your Situation
After going through this process, here’s my advice for picking an online mba dubai program:
If You’re Early Career (Under 5 Years Experience)
Tbh you might want to wait or consider a traditional MBA. Most good online mba dubai programs prefer candidates with 5+ years work experience. I’ve seen younger people struggle in my cohort because they lack context for applying the concepts.
If you’re set on it now, look for online mba dubai programs that accept early-career candidates and have strong career support services.
If You’re Mid-Career (5-15 Years)
This is the sweet spot for online mba dubai programs. You have enough experience to contribute to discussions and apply concepts, but you’re not too senior that opportunity cost is massive.
Budget 75k-120k AED and expect 18-30 months duration. Look for online mba dubai programs with good networking opportunities and career services.
If You’re Senior/Executive Level
Consider Executive MBA options over regular online mba dubai programs. EMBAs are faster (12-18 months), cohorts are more senior, and content is more strategic. More expensive (150k-250k AED) but designed for your level.
If You’re Budget-Conscious
There ARE affordable online mba dubai options that are legitimate. Look at programs from Indian universities with Dubai recognition (Amity, Manipal) or UK universities offering online mba dubai degrees (University of Bradford, Coventry). Range is 45k-70k AED typically.
Just verify accreditation carefully. Cheap doesn’t mean bad, but suspiciously cheap usually means fake.

💡 Verify Accreditation BEFORE Paying Anything
This is THE most important thing – I lost 8k AED learning this lesson the hard way. Don’t just trust the online mba dubai website’s claims. Physically call UAE Ministry of Education to confirm recognition, check the accrediting body’s official website (AACSB.edu, AMBA.org, etc.), and ask for names of alumni you can contact. If a program hesitates to provide this info, run. Legit programs are proud of their accreditation and will show you everything. Also Google “[university name] accreditation scam” – if there’s complaints, you’ll find them.
💡 Talk to Current Students, Not Just Sales Staff
Sales people at online mba dubai programs will tell you what you want to hear (shocking, I know lol). Ask for contact info of 3-5 current students and actually call them. Ask about workload reality, platform quality, professor responsiveness, job placement support, hidden costs, and whether they’d recommend it. I did this before choosing Heriot-Watt and the honest feedback from students was WAY more valuable than the polished marketing materials. If a program won’t connect you with students, that’s a red flag.
💡 Negotiate Payment Plans Aggressively
Most online mba dubai programs have flexible payment options but won’t advertise them. I negotiated my 85k AED tuition into 8 quarterly payments instead of the standard 4 installments, which helped cash flow SO much. Ask about early payment discounts (some offer 5-10% off), employer sponsorship arrangements, alumni referral discounts, or extended payment plans. The worst they can say is no, and tbh most programs want your enrollment badly enough to work with you on payment terms.
